Northrop Grumman Marine systems is seeking an Additive Technologies Principal Investigator Level 4 to drive the technical business strategy, development, and execution of heavy industrial additive manufacturing activities. A presence in Sunnyvale, California is preferred but is not required for this role. This position is for a dynamic role within Northrop Grumman's Marine Systems Materials Engineering and Processes team. A Principal Investigator (PI) will work closely with other materials engineers, design engineering, manufacturing engineering, advanced development, and executive leadership, and our customers to develop and execute technical strategy for industrial use of additive manufacturing. This includes identify use cases on current and future programs, securing funding, and assisting with messaging to customers. The PI will also be required to work tactically with program management, contracts, internal supply chain, and our suppliers to drive execution to schedule. The individual in this position will be driving innovation and business-level activities but will need to have a strong understanding of the technologies involved.
